Transaction 0695adc000093670127c01b21aee42f5aae4eaff60ffe716b40c74d36b8fb910

3 Input
2 Outputs
  • 0695adc000093670127c01b21aee42f5aae4eaff60ffe716b40c74d36b8fb910:0
  • value  49901154
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 0695adc000093670127c01b21aee42f5aae4eaff60ffe716b40c74d36b8fb910:1
  • value  21725
    address  3Q9yAfByofnstFm9V7fPY2vQKEBG1VcCSh